Transaction 34103b6795607632ba3b3de346941d9105935a794b2e8bc373ecc8bdf103f139
1 Input
2 Outputs
- 34103b6795607632ba3b3de346941d9105935a794b2e8bc373ecc8bdf103f139:0
- 34103b6795607632ba3b3de346941d9105935a794b2e8bc373ecc8bdf103f139:1
value 471581945
address 19CFm2wpCVEf6WefoFjDm3hnPDvGP91B9d
value 3261806
address 14jptYuv7cqeJos4qYi5MdLyDpFmgaShVu